This was a chore to get through. I expect heavy suspense in my gothics - sweaty hands, maybe something slithery in the pit of my stomach but I got nothing but boredom here. The author spends inordinate time on description and the heroine's internal dialogue to the point where a single, short conversation between two people may take a dozen pages. To make matters worse, the heroine is a dim witted mouse whose head I have no desire to spend inside of. When the hero wonders what and why it is he is drawn to the heroine for, the reader is left wondering the same thing since we don't really know what she looks like or what she is about except that everyone treats her pretty poorly, she acts like a twit and spends an inordinate amount time thinking about her sad past which makes the reader feel like she only feels sorry for herself. She sneaks around the house, jumps at her own shadows and doesn't make a single effort to do something positive for herself like move forward with her life especially seeing how lucky she is to have gotten that job and was so quickly elevated to a position that allows her to do what she loves more than anything. Grow a spine girl! Disappointing read and not recommended.

I did like this story very much, but I give it 3 stars instead of 4 due to its graphic sex scenes which I did not think were necessary for the story line. I did not notice any editing mistakes and the story ran smoothly. The heroine, however, was a twit and continually did stupid things to put herself in danger. I found the author's take on the Jack the Ripper theme interesting. ****SPOILER*** She did take liberties on having JTR follow Darcie out of Whitechapel, which I doubt would have happened since the killings appeared to have been unplanned.The real Jack the Ripper went into Whitechapel looking for a prostitute to kill and when he found one, he would kill her if he found the opportunity. He would not have followed one out of Whitechapel and waited months to kill her.Anyway, back to the story. I do like that she wrapped up the story and I don't have to wait for a book 2. There was a HEA for almost everyone involved, which I also liked. I do recommend this book, only if you can deal with the sex scenes or if you are like me and can just skip over the sex scenes. If you can't deal with the sex scenes, then just skip this book.

About the Author

Brian Michael Bendis is an award-winning comics creator, New York Times bestseller and one of the most successful writers working in mainstream comics. In his 20 years at Marvel Comics, he produced some of the greatest graphic novels the publisher has ever seen and created popular characters Jessica Jones and Spider Man: Miles Morales.He is also known for his contributions to the crime/noir genre with creator-owned works for his Jinxworld imprint.In 2018 Brian moved to DC Comics where he made his DC debut in the landmark Action Comics #1000. He currently writes Superman and Action comics as well as 4 new original series under the Jinxworld banner and is also curating a custom line of comics called Wonder Comics focusing on young heroes as the protagonists. He currently lives in Portland, Oregon with his family.

About the Author

Bernard Howell Leach (1887―1979) was a British studio potter and art teacher. He founded the Leach Pottery in St. Ives and taught some of the most celebrated ceramicists of the twentieth century.

Contemporary philosophy tends to try to illuminate particular phenomena. It is rightly suspicious of sweeping generalizations that explain all of reality. Schopenhauer, however, is not of this inclination. As he states, this whole book is merely the illustration of a single idea which, surprisingly, explains metaphysics, ethics, aesthetics, epistemology and even political philosophy. If one were to fault Schopenhauer it would not be for lack of ambition.Essentially, his idea is not new but was expressed by the ancient Indian sages in the Vedas and, with a slightly different perspective, in the teachings of Buddha. The world of appearance is, at its root, the expression of a single ever-questing will. This will reaches its epitome in man but the same will is found in animals, plants and even inorganic matter.The secret to life is then to recognize that this insatiable will leads only to suffering. By recognizing that all is fundamentally one and no longer asserting one’s own will above others one can escape the futility of trying to satisfy its demands.Art is then merely a temporary realization of this fundamental reality while the ethical saint is the one who fully recognizes the need to subordinate the will. Immorality is the imposition of one’s own will over another. Human rights are merely assertions of the impropriety of having one’s will dominated. The state is what guarantees these human rights.If one likes systems that explain everything, or if you share the Buddhist outlook on wants as the basis of suffering, one will enjoy Schopenhauer’s masterpiece. It is clear, well-written and mostly free of philosophical jargon making it accessible to any reader.Personally, I think the account bares little relevance to modernity. A pastiche of Kantianism and Buddhism, it contains parts which might be true. However, these ideas are more rigorously grounded in contemporary neuroscience, a field obviously inaccessible in Schopenhauer’s day.Ultimately, I would shy away from Schopenhauer’s philosophical views based on Kant’s reflections on the mind and rely more on verifiable scientific theories of human nature.But I recognize that Schopenhauer’s marriage of Kant and Eastern thought has not only brought solace to millions but is itself a work of genius. For all those seeking a system which explains everything by means of an elusive but essentially simple idea, Schopenhauer’s work is worth reflecting upon. Those with a more modern/scientific perspective may safely ignore an ingenious system that, in this reviewer’s opinion, is now somewhat passé.
